HOTSPOT - You have an Azure subscription that contains a storage account named storage1 and several virtual machines. The storage account and virtual machines are in the same Azure region. The network configurations of the virtual machines are shown in the following table.The virtual network subnets have service endpoints defined as shown in the following table.
You configure the following Firewall and virtual networks settings for storage1: ✑ Allow access from: Selected networks ✑ Virtual networks: VNET3Subnet3 Firewall `" Address range: 52.233.129.0/24
For each of the following statements, select Yes if the statement is true. Otherwise, select No. NOTE: Each correct selection is worth one point. Hot Area:
Suggested Answer:
Box 1: No - VNet1 has a service endpoint configure for Azure Storage. However, the Azure storage does not allow access from VNet1 or the public IP address of VM1. Box 2: Yes - VNet2 does not have a service endpoint configured. However, the Azure storage allows access from the public IP address of VM2. Box 3: No - Azure storage allows access from VNet3. However, VNet3 does not have a service endpoint for Azure storage. The Azure storage also does not allow access from the public IP of VM3.
